%X 钛合金以其优异的性能广泛应用于包括骨科在内的多个临床研究方向,钛合金材料整体性能进一步的提升,使得钛合金内植物相关感染成为亟待解决的问题。临床治疗内植物相关感染通常存在滞后性,因此通过赋予钛合金一定的抗菌性能以预防游离细菌的入侵、粘附避免感染的发生。添加抗菌金属银使钛合金具有抗菌性能是目前研究的热点,因此,本文将以含银钛合金的抗菌性能研究为重点进行详细论述。
Titanium alloys are widely used in several clinical research directions including orthopedics for their excellent properties, and with the further improvement of the overall performance of titanium alloy materials, it makes titanium alloy endophyte-associated infections an urgent problem. Clinical treatment of endophyte-associated infections usually has a lag, so titanium alloys are given certain antimicrobial properties to prevent the invasion of free bacteria, adhesion to avoid the occurrence of infection. The addition of silver as an antimicrobial metal to make titanium alloys with antimi-crobial properties is a hot topic of research, therefore, this paper will focus on the antimicrobial properties of silver-containing titanium alloys for detailed discussion.
